> Out of 152 hospitals in the state, patients scored Maimonides the worst in multiple categories, including “patient’s room and bathroom always kept clean,” “patients always got help as soon as they wanted,” “nurses always communicated well” and “staff always explained about medicines.” Also, patients are more likely to have complications like bloodstream and antibiotic-resistant staph infections than at an average hospital, according to the federal Centers for Medicaid and Medicare Services, which gave the facility two out of five stars.
